The Effect of Flexibility in Improving the Quality of Interior Architecture of Minimum Housing, Case Study: Haruki’s Apartment (A Super Small Apartment)

Abstract:

The increasing trend of population growth and migration to big cities in the last few decades has created a crisis in the field of housing, and the importance of mass production of residential units has been raised more than ever. In the current situation, due to the high cost of housing, the design and production of small-sized residential units have become more popular, and many families, despite not meeting their needs, have agreed to live in small-sized units. The design of small apartment units based on flexibility can lead to the optimal use of space and meet many people’s needs. The current research aims to find the characteristics of minimum housing, analyze how flexibility works in minimum housing, and examine the conceptual model of flexibility in a case study. The research method of the present study is descriptive-analytical. In the first step, through library and documentary studies, the analysis of the practical components to improve the flexibility of the minimum housing has been done, and the conceptual model has been extracted. In the second step, the research model has been analyzed and examined in the case of Haruki’s apartment. The findings show that flexibility in the housing space helps meet the audience’s needs. It can be done in three stages: Design of the structure and space (hard work). Method of the final coating on the structure (thin work). Furniture and equipment are among the solutions to improve Spatial quality benefit. The results show that flexibility components have been paid attention to in the case sample (Haruki’s apartment), in the stiffening section of the mezzanine, to make the space multifunctional, in the carpentry section of folding and changeable windows to meet the needs and reduce visual disturbances, and in the equipment and furniture section. Folding and movable furniture have been used.
